Now all the SHOWN … WebClick Move Component or Rotate Component (Assembly toolbar). In the PropertyManager, under Options, select Collision Detection. If the component you are moving touches any other component in the assembly, the collision is detected. Select components for the …

Web1. Click Move Component or Rotate Component present in the Assembly toolbar. 2. In the PropertyManager, under Options, select Collision Detection. Under Check between, select: …
